Danette's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Splitting Danette's full recorded timeline at 1979, 14%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 86% in the earlier half -- the name was more prevalent in its earlier era than it is today. Its quietest year on record was 1930,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 1966 peak of 501 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

Danette by state
Where Danette concentrates geographically, total births since 1930
| Rank | State | Visual share | Births | Share of total |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| #1 | California | | 1,358 | 13.1% |
| #2 | Illinois | | 561 | 5.4% |
| #3 | New York | | 512 | 4.9% |
| #4 | Texas | | 511 | 4.9% |
| #5 | Pennsylvania | | 482 | 4.6% |
| #6 | Ohio | | 479 | 4.6% |
| #7 | Michigan | | 370 | 3.6% |
| #8 | Washington | | 288 | 2.8% |
1,358 of 10,392 births nationwide. Compared to a flat distribution across 44 reporting states.
